WebSybil Birling, the wife of Arthur Birling, is described by Priestley as being her 50s, her husband’s ‘social superior’ and ‘cold’. She is the head of a local charity as mentioned before and is a conservative housewife. She very much believes in traditional roles and norms including of behaviour as we can see from these two quotes. Analyzes how mr. birling's character is depicted as a stubborn, obnoxious and self-obesessed man. he wants to make money from this innocent marriage and the quicker it … WebMar 9, 2024 · The Inspector serves multiple functions with the play: To make the character confess their actions. To control and encourage speech and movement on stage. To instigate moments of tension and intrigue. To act as a vehicle for Priestley’s moral message. To encourage the characters and audience to learn from the mistakes of the past.
